Templeton Emerging Markets Income Fund Inc. (TEI) is a closed-end fund focused on generating yield from emerging market fixed income and related assets, trading at $6.01 as of 2026-04-06, representing a 0.58% decline from its prior closing price. This analysis covers key technical levels, recent market context for the emerging markets income sector, and potential scenarios for TEI’s price action in the upcoming weeks.
